Enable Unknown Sources - Before installing the Minecraft APK on your Android device, you need to enable the "Unknown Sources" option. This allows you to install apps from sources other than the Google Play Store. To do this, go to your device's settings and navigate to the "Security" or "Privacy" section. Look for the "Unknown sources" option and turn it on.

Install Minecraft APK – After downloading the Minecraft APK file, place it in your device's Downloads folder or a designated file location. Click on the APK file to start the installation process. You may be asked to confirm permissions or grant specific access to apps. Read and verify the requested permissions before proceeding with the installation.
Completing the installation: The installation process may take several minutes. Once the process is complete, a notification will appear indicating that Minecraft mod apk has been successfully installed on your device. Now you can access the game from the app drawer or home screen.
